Transaction 19484a011a50661ae3f32d9552109214c473fa771fcd4a363c05bb5d1639fa12

1 Input
1 Outputs
  • 19484a011a50661ae3f32d9552109214c473fa771fcd4a363c05bb5d1639fa12:0
  • value  7103765
    address  33ctTZBjrT45FEra4E4VwgXRKWjdCjdkNZ